What Is Landlord Building Insurance?
There are many different facets to landlord building insurance that are extremely important to evaluate. Too often property owners have underinsured their rental property due to trying to save money. You should also check the benefits of the policy to ensure that you have enough coverage.
As a rule landlord insurance policies cover the structure of the building or rental unit. These policies will cover damages due to fire, and even vandalism. These are bothare very common coverage that will give the basic protection. However you have to tune the policy to your needs and add in other types of cover. Since you’re dealing with tenants, it is probably important to make sure that the policy includes the fixtures, carpet and flooring, as well as windows and any other permanently attached item. These items are usually the most frequent ones that have be replaced due to damage.
Usuallyyour building contains appliances or other items that you own, and then you want to make sure that your policy also includes for placement of these in case they are stolen or damaged. It can be easy to forget to have these included in your insurance policy. Numerous insurance policies only cover if there is a break in and not theft that is incurred by the tenant. You are able to include many add ons into your policy to ensure you have enough protection.
You will also want to make sure that you have high enough limits set. You can determine some of these by evaluating how much would cost to replace the building in the contents in case of a disaster.
